1 John 1, shares the message of life as something real, seen, heard, and experienced firsthand, now proclaimed so others may share in true fellowship with the Father and with His Son. This fellowship is marked by fullness of joy and is rooted in the truth that God is pure light, with no darkness at all. Teaching that walking in that light means living in truth and openness, not claiming closeness with God while continuing in darkness. Honest acknowledgment of sin is essential; denying it is self-deception. But when sin is confessed, God is faithful and just to forgive and to cleanse completely, restoring right relationship.
